Atmospheric pressure Zadra stripping was the first commercially successful process developed for stripping gold from carbon The process was developed by J B Zadra and others at the Bureau of Mines USBM in the early 1950 s The results of their research were first applied at Golden Cycle Gold Corporation s Carlton Mill at Victor

The Elution and Goldroom plant is the final step in the gold process flowsheet where the gold cyanide complex is desorbed from the activated carbon recovered as a metal in the electrowinning cells and refined to dor gold bars in the gold room The activated carbon is regenerated for reuse in the cyanide leaching section Key benefits

Our electrowinning cells Treating 15 80 gallons per minute 18m 3 /hr of pregnant solution our electrowinning cells can be used with all types of metal recovery systems including Zadra and AARL elution high grade leaching and intensive cyanidation from gravity systems They have also been used successfully with non cyanide metal bearing solutions
